WordPress non può entrare in background?Risolvi il problema che reauth=1 non può accedere e non può entrare

MoltiMarketing su Internettutti stanno usandoWordPressOttimizzazione per i motori di ricerca.

Tuttavia, a volte all'improvvisoAccedi al backend di WordPressSe non riesci ad entrare, continuerai a saltare ripetutamente a tale connessione▼

https://域名/wp-login.php?redirect_to=https%3A%2F%2F域名%2Fwp-admin%2F&reauth = 1

Questa situazione di impossibilità di accedere a WordPress è un fenomeno comune:

  • Nell'interfaccia di accesso in background, dopo aver inserito la password dell'account,
  • Fare clic per entrare, non c'è risposta e richiesta...
  • Non riesco ad accedere anche se cambio browser.

Soluzione 1

Passo 1:Apri i file di sistema di WordPress▼

/wp-includes/pluggable.php

Passo 2:Usa lo strumento di ricerca per trovare questa riga di codice▼

setcookie($ auth_cookie_name,$ auth_cookie,$ expire,ADMIN_COOKIE_PATH,COOKIE_DOMAIN,$ secure,true);
  • Nota che diverse versioni di WordPress possono avere diverse righe di codice.

Passo 3:Tutto quello che devi fare è trovare tutti questi codici e sostituirli con ▼

setcookie($ auth_cookie_name,$ auth_cookie,$ expire,SITECOOKIEPATH,COOKIE_DOMAIN,$ secure,true);

Soluzione 2

I plugin di WordPress a volte possono causare questo problema se c'è un conflitto tra i due plugin.

Disabilita tutti i plugin:

  1. Utilizza un client FTP per connetterti al tuo host web.
  2. volontà/wp-content/plugins/directory, rinominata inplugins_backup.
  3. Questo disabiliterà tutte le installazioni sul tuo sitoPlugin WordPress.

Dopo aver disabilitato tutti i plugin, prova ad accedere al tuo sito WordPress.

  • Se accedi correttamente, se vedi un errore di plug-in in background, significa che uno dei tuoi plug-in sta causando il problema.
  • Basta passare tramite FTPsoftware, rinomina il plugin (rinomina il tasto di scelta rapida: F2), puoi disabilitare direttamente il plugin.

Soluzione 3

Se usi la ridenominazione della directory dei plugin, disabilita tuttoPlugin WP, effettuato correttamente l'accessoBackend di WordPresse non è stato visualizzato un messaggio di errore del plug-in.

Visualizza solo errori simili ai seguenti ▼

警告:无法修改标题信息 - 已在(home /用户名/ web / domainname /public_html/wp-content/advanced-cache.php:26中发送的标题)/ home /用户名/ web / domain名/第1116行的public_html / wp-admin / includes / misc.php

警告:无法修改标题信息 - 已在(home /用户名/ web / domainname /public_html/wp-content/advanced-cache.php:26中发送的标题)/ home /用户名/ web / domain名/第919行的public_html / wp-includes / option.php

警告:无法修改标题信息 - 已在(home /用户名/ web / domainname /public_html/wp-content/advanced-cache.php:26中发送的标题)/ home /用户名/ web / domain名/第920行的public_html / wp-includes / option.php

Quindi potrebbe non essere un plugin di WordPress a causare l'errore.

Quanto segue èChen WeiangTestare la soluzione alternativa per un accesso riuscito:

Con "Modifica rapida", lascia che WordPress apra una piccola finestra di accesso▼

Finestra di accesso piccola pop-up per WordPress

  1. Vai alla pagina di modifica dei post di WordPress /wp-admin/edit.php
  2. Enable Back Plugin: torna a ciò che è stato modificato in precedenzaPlugin WPNome della directory.
  3. Nella pagina di modifica dell'articolo, fai clic su "Modifica rapida".
  4. Dopo aver fatto clic su "Modifica rapida", attendi qualche secondo e verrà visualizzata una piccola finestra di accesso, che richiede l'account di accesso e la password.
  5. Inserisci la password dell'account e potrai accedere con successo.

(Perché l'accesso non verrà reindirizzato aprendo la "finestra di accesso piccola")

soluzione finale

Rimuovere il codice aggiunto manualmente di functions.php:

  • Se hai aggiunto manualmente altro codice nel tuo file functions.php, esegui prima il backup del codice.
  • Quindi, prova a rimuovere il codice che hai aggiunto manualmente.
  • Se riesci ad accedere con successo al backend di WordPress dopo averlo eliminato, significa che c'è un problema con il codice del file functions.php.
  • Hai bisogno di controllare uno per uno, quale codice è sbagliato?
  • Promozione WebL'operatore ha affermato che il test utilizza il seguente metodo di "eliminazione di 2/1 del codice per eseguire il debug dell'errore" e l'eliminazione corretta di un codice aggiunto manualmente risolverà perfettamente il problema.

Rimuovere 2/1 codice di debug

Passo 1:Elimina prima metà del codice funzione

  • Ad esempio, se aggiungi manualmente 10 codici funzione nel file functions.php, prima prova ed elimina metà (5) codici.

Passo 2:Finestra di navigazione in incognito del browser, riaccedi al backend di WordPress

  • Se scopri di poter accedere con successo al backend di WordPress, significa che la metà del codice che hai appena eliminato è sbagliata.
  • Se non riesci ad accedere correttamente al backend di WordPress, questa metà del codice non eliminato è errata.

passo 3: continua a testare la metà del codice che non riesce

  • Continua a ripetere i 2 passaggi precedenti per testare la metà del codice di errore finché non accedi correttamente al backend di WordPress.

Speranza Chen Weiliang Blog ( https://www.chenweiliang.com/ ) ha condiviso "WordPress non può entrare in background?Risolvi il problema che reauth=1 non può accedere e non può accedere", ti aiuterà.

Benvenuti a condividere il link di questo articolo:https://www.chenweiliang.com/cwl-740.html

Benvenuto nel canale Telegram del blog di Chen Weiliang per ricevere gli ultimi aggiornamenti!

🔔 Sii il primo a ricevere la preziosa "Guida all'utilizzo dello strumento AI di marketing dei contenuti ChatGPT" nella directory principale del canale! 🌟
📚 Questa guida contiene un valore enorme, 🌟Questa è un'opportunità rara, non perderla! ⏰⌛💨
Condividi e metti mi piace se ti va!
La tua condivisione e i tuoi like sono la nostra continua motivazione!

 

发表 评论

L'indirizzo email non verrà pubblicato. 必填 项 已 用 * 标注

滚动 到 顶部